Data Aggregation Layer Evolution

Architecture

Data aggregation layer evolution within cryptocurrency, options trading, and financial derivatives signifies a shift from disparate data silos to integrated, real-time information streams. This progression necessitates robust infrastructure capable of handling high-velocity, high-volume data from multiple exchanges, decentralized finance protocols, and traditional financial institutions. Modern architectures prioritize modularity and scalability, employing technologies like message queues and distributed databases to ensure resilience and low latency, critical for algorithmic trading and risk management. Consequently, the evolution focuses on standardized APIs and data formats to facilitate seamless integration and reduce operational complexity.
